This Yunomi is a long-selling favorite in Japan for more than 20 years. Turned upside down, each Yunomi looks like Mt. Fuji. SUSONO and MIHO are both famous views of Mt. Fuji. Combination of sunrise and crane is one of the most auspicious omen motifs. Pine is also an auspicious omen...

The name of this CHAZUTSU refers to a tea jar with a special shape or form. It is said that it is very difficult even for the veteran craftsman to form wood into a complex shape like this. Besides, body, lid, and inner lid, also must fit...

The name of this CHAZUTSU refers to a small ball. TEMARI means ball, and KO means small in Japanese. This CHAZUTSU is very beautiful and spreads gracefulness around, so this is also suitable for display in your home or office...

RYUBOKU means driftwood and hints WABI SABI atmosphere in Japanese. The rim, top surface, center, side, and base are all designed with natural and simple atmosphere, which brings out the beauty of Japanese zelkova...

Karigane is made from the stems of Gyokuro and high grade Sencha. We combined three valuable Karigane items: Gyokuro Karigane Superior, Sencha Karigane , and Houjicha Karigane...

Genmaicha and Houjicha contain less caffeine than other Japanese teas. And they are suitable for everyday because of the affordable prices. We chose and combined four of our most unique and delightful teas to make this special set: Genmaicha, Genmaicha Matcha-iri, Houjicha, and Houjicha Karigane...
